Interactive web is a browser-based experience that can add a digital layer to a physical object, a brand moment, or a webpage. No installation needed.
For brands, it can make a card, package, badge, poster, garment, pitch deck, or product page feel more alive, memorable, and useful.

The point is not to build the biggest possible thing. The point is to create one clear interaction that makes sense for the object, audience, and moment.
